The Unipol Domus is a football stadium in Cagliari, Sardinia, Italy. Built in 2017 as Sardegna Arena, it has hosted Cagliari Calcio football matches since the 2017–18 season, following the closure and partial demolition of Stadio Sant'Elia. Stadio Amsicora is a multi-use stadium in Cagliari, Italy. It was used mostly for football matches and was the home of Cagliari Calcio. The stadium was able to hold 34,000 spectators at its height. Stadio Amsicora is situated 1¼ km west of Fortino Seconda Guerra Mondiale.

Quartu Sant'Elena, located four miles East from Cagliari on the ancient Roman road, is a city and comune in the Metropolitan City of Cagliari, Sardinia, Italy. It is the third largest city of Sardinia with a population of 68,108 as of 2025. Quartu Sant’Elena is situated 4½ km northeast of Fortino Seconda Guerra Mondiale.

Monserrato is a comune in the Metropolitan City of Cagliari, southern Sardinia, Italy, located about 5 kilometres northeast of Cagliari. Monserrato borders the following municipalities: Cagliari, Quartu Sant'Elena, Quartucciu, Selargius, Sestu. Monserrato is situated 5 km north of Fortino Seconda Guerra Mondiale.
